Ottavino, we hardly knew yo.

rotoworld:

"Rockies claimed RHP Adam Ottavino off waivers from the Cardinals; optioned him to Triple-A Colorado Springs.
That didn't take long. Ottavino was pushed off the Cards' 40-man roster on Tuesday afternoon, but found a new home within hours. He had a 4.85 ERA, 1.60 WHIP and 120/71 K/BB ratio in 141 innings last year at Triple-A. "

How is the waiver order determined at the beginning of the season? Is it based on last year's record?

Yes, until the All-Star break, I believe, when they start using the current year's standings instead.

Houston, Chicago, San Diego, Florida, and Pittsburgh all had worse records in 2011 than did Colorado - which means they all passed on Ottavino before the Rockies put in their claim.

If Otto had to pass through the AL as well, four AL teams also had worse records than the Rox - Minnesota, Seattle, Baltimore, and Kansas City.
